Description

A most attractive and characterful cottage located in a wonderful semi rural position which now offers great potential to modernise to a buyer's own taste as well as an opportunity extend, subject to the necessary consents. The property enjoys a south facing garden and has views over neighbouring fields and is being sold with no onward chain.

Situation - Located in a semi rural location with farmland views to the front yet within a ten minute walk of Hurst Green commuter railway station with frequent train service to London Bridge and London Victoria taking around 40 minutes. The Haycutter country pub and restaurant is found 200m away offering a warm friendly greeting and good food.

Oxted town centre is approximately one mile away and offers a wide range of restaurants, boutique and coffee shops, supermarkets, together with leisure pool complex, cinema and library.

The locality is well served for a wide range of state and private schools for children of all ages, together with sporting facilities such as golf clubs including Limpsfield Chart and Tandridge golf clubs, as well as The Limpsfield Club (racquet sports).

For the M25 commuter, access at Godstone Junction 6 gives road connections to other motorway networks, Dartford Crossing, Heathrow Airport and via the M23 Gatwick Airport.

Enclosed Entrance Porch -

Hallway - Stairs to first floor, low level cupboard under stairs, wall light points.

Living Room - Feature open fireplace with marble surround and hearth, fitted bookshelves, low level cupboards.

Kitchen - Range of fitted worktops, eye and base level cupboards, freestanding cooker and fridge/freezer, part tiled walls.

Conservatory - Double doors to garden.

Utility Cupboard/ Wc - Bosch washing machine, wall shelves, electric light.

First Floor Landing - Large trap to loft with extending loft ladder, part boarded with electric light, wall mounted Potterton gas fired boiler.

Bedroom - Large built-in wardrobe cupboard over stairs, partial views.

Bedroom - Farmland views.

Large Bathroom - Enclosed bath with Aqualisa wall mounted shower, shower screen, low suite w.c, wash hand basin, tiled floor, fitted airing cupboard with hot tank and immersion heater.

Outside - Off road parking to front for two vehicles.

South facing rear garden predominantly laid to lawn with mature boundary hedging, bordered to the rear by a stream. Two brick built storage cupboards/sheds.
